A fine and highly decorative mid-19th century French Louis XV style fold-over card or games table, dating to circa 1850, of elegant serpentine form and beautifully veneered in richly figured burr walnut.
The shaped fold-over top opens to reveal a baize-lined playing surface, making the piece both practical and visually striking. The serpentine frieze is raised on graceful cabriole legs, embellished with ornate gilt metal mounts and sabots in the Rococo taste, enhancing its distinctly French decorative appeal.
The burr walnut veneers display particularly attractive figuring and warm colour throughout, with the shaped outline and flowing proportions giving the table exceptional elegance from every angle. When closed, it serves beautifully as a sophisticated occasional or centre table; when opened, it becomes a practical and charming games table.
